Multi-microphone drum recording techniques benefit enormously from channel strip plugins that include phase alignment and polarity controls. When multiple microphones capture the same drum kit from different positions, timing differences between microphones can cause phase cancellation that thins the sound. A channel strip with a sample-accurate delay control allows you to align the arrival times of different microphones. Combined with polarity inversion, these phase tools ensure that all drum microphones sum constructively for a full, powerful sound.

The sidechain filter on a channel strip compressor allows you to shape which frequencies trigger the compression detector without affecting the actual audio output. High-pass filtering the sidechain prevents low-frequency content from causing excessive gain reduction, which is particularly useful on full-range material like a mix bus or bass-heavy instruments. Some channel strips allow you to listen to the sidechain signal in isolation, making it easier to dial in the filter settings accurately.

The concept of pre-delay on reverb sends controls the time gap between the dry signal and the onset of the reverb tail. Increasing the pre-delay separates the dry sound from its reverb, maintaining clarity and intimacy while still providing spatial context. Short pre-delay times create a tighter, more integrated reverb sound, while longer pre-delay times push the reverb back in the perceived space. Pre-delay adjustment is a powerful tool for controlling the perceived distance and clarity of reverbed sources in a mix.

The concept of frequency masking occurs when two instruments occupy the same frequency range, causing one or both to sound unclear in the mix. Channel strip plugins address masking through their EQ sections, allowing you to carve complementary frequency curves on competing instruments. For example, boosting the bass guitar at 100 Hz while cutting the same frequency on the kick drum creates space for both instruments to be heard clearly. This approach to EQ within a channel strip framework produces mixes with exceptional clarity and separation.

The art of applying EQ to vocals demands familiarity with the frequency ranges that contribute to different perceptual qualities of the human voice. Warmth and body reside between 100 and 300 Hz. Clarity and presence occupy the 2 to 5 kHz range. Air and openness live above 8 kHz. Nasal and muddy qualities concentrate around 300 to 600 Hz. Harshness typically appears between 2 and 4 kHz depending on the singer. Knowing these ranges enables precise, effective vocal EQ decisions.

The look-ahead feature available in some channel strip compressors introduces a small delay that allows the compressor to react to transients before they arrive. This millisecond-range delay gives the compressor time to begin gain reduction ahead of a transient peak, resulting in more transparent compression with better transient control. Look-ahead is particularly effective on percussive instruments where the initial transient is critical to the sound's impact. The trade-off is a slight increase in latency, which modern DAWs compensate for automatically.

Parallel compression, also known as New York compression, is a technique that works exceptionally well through channel strip plugins with a mix knob. By blending heavily compressed signal with the unprocessed original, you retain the natural dynamics and transient detail while adding the weight and sustain of aggressive compression. This technique is particularly effective on drums, where it adds power without sacrificing the initial attack. Many modern channel strip plugins include a dedicated mix control specifically for this purpose.

Harmonic distortion in channel strip plugins comes in two primary flavors: even-order and odd-order harmonics. Even-order harmonics, typical of tube and transformer circuits, add warmth and fullness that is generally perceived as pleasant. Odd-order harmonics, more common in transistor and op-amp circuits, create a grittier, more aggressive character. The balance between these harmonic types defines the sonic personality of each channel strip plugin and determines which sources it flatters most.

The relationship between sample rate and channel strip plugin behavior becomes apparent when comparing the same plugin processing identical material at different rates. Higher sample rates extend the frequency range above human hearing, providing additional headroom for the harmonic generation and saturation algorithms within the channel strip. This additional bandwidth allows harmonics and aliasing artifacts to fold back at higher, less audible frequencies. How do I automate channel strip plugin parameters during a mix?
Most DAWs expose channel strip plugin parameters for automation through the automation lane system. In Pro Tools, enable the automation mode and select the desired parameter from the plugin's parameter list. In Logic Pro, use the automation dropdown to choose plugin parameters. In Ableton Live, click the automation button and unfold the plugin to reveal its parameters. Common automation targets include compressor threshold, EQ gain, and output level.
Can I use channel strip plugins with Ableton Live?
Yes, Ableton Live supports channel strip plugins in both VST3 and AU formats on Mac, and VST3 on Windows. Insert the channel strip on any audio or MIDI track's device chain. Ableton Live also allows you to create custom channel strip configurations using Audio Effect Racks that combine the stock EQ, Compressor, Saturator, and Gate with macro controls.
